If there are 208 beats per minute, and the music is in 4/4 time, how many measures of music would occur in one minute?
7nadin3 [17]

Answer:

52 measures

Step-by-step explanation:

With 4 beats per measure, and 208 beats per minute all we need to do here is divide 208 by 4 to get 52.
